故障转移与操作系统的可靠性是现代计算机系统设计中的关键因素。随着信息技术的飞速发展,企业对系统的高可用性要求也逐渐提高。这不仅关系到业务的连续性,也是确保用户体验的重要保障。为实现高可用性系统,故障转移机制成为了不可或缺的一部分。通过合理设计和实施这一机制,系统能够在出现故障时迅速切换到备份资源,最大限度降低服务中断时间,从而提升整个系统的可靠性。

在设计高可用性系统时,首先需要选定适合的操作系统。这些操作系统通常具备优异的故障恢复能力,能够在系统发生错误时进行自我修复。它们还应支持多种资源管理和监控工具,以实时检测系统状态。这些工具不仅能发现故障,还能自动触发故障转移流程,确保服务不受影响。
故障转移的实现方式多种多样,包括主动-被动和主动-主动两种模式。主动-被动模式中,一台主服务器处理所有请求,备用服务器仅在主机故障时接管。而主动-主动模式则允许多台服务器同时处理请求,不仅提高了系统的整体效率,也增强了故障容错能力。在选择合适的模式时,企业需要根据自身的业务需求和预算作出明智的决策。
定期的系统备份和测试是保障高可用性的重要环节。通过仿真各种故障情境,可以评估系统的反应能力和恢复速度。这种测试不仅可以发现潜在问题,还能帮助运维人员熟悉故障处理流程,积累经验,从而在真实故障发生时更加从容应对。
员工的培训和团队的合作亦是确保高可用性系统运转的关键。在系统维护过程中,技术人员应了解系统的架构和运行机制,能够迅速定位问题并采取相应措施。跨部门的协作也能提高整体运作效率,使公司在面对突发事件时更具韧性。
通过以上措施,企业能够实现高可用性系统,确保其在面对各种挑战时保持稳定性和可靠性,最终提升用户满意度,增强市场竞争力。
